Jerry Ervin White was born October 9, 1935 in Dustin, Oklahoma to Opal Stella and Jerry Harvey White. He passed away November 4, 2016 at Elk City, Oklahoma at the age of 81 years and 25 days.

Jerry moved with his family to Elk City as a young child in 1944 and later to Cheyenne in 1952. In 1955 the family moved back to the Elk City area where he graduated from Merritt High School. After graduation Jerry continued to help his father farm until 1969 when he was married to Glenda Pricilla (McCamon) White at Elk City, Oklahoma on March 1st. Jerry and Glenda moved to Oklahoma City where he worked for the city of Oklahoma City and later Sooner Box Company. They returned to Elk City in 1977 where they made their home and Jerry went to work in the oil field. It wasn’t until the early 90’s that Jerry got out of the oil field and went to work for Atwoods. In 1993 Jerry began working for Walmart and continued until his retirement in 2005. After Glenda’s passing on August 30, 2004, he met Lou Carpenter and they were eventually married on July 4, 2005. Together they remained in Elk City where they shared and enjoyed retirement together. Jerry enjoyed fishing, playing his guitar, singing, tinkering with projects outdoors and spending time with his family and friends.

He was preceded in death by his parents, both wives, one brother, Virgil White and 3 sisters, Irene Hill, Mayo Scott Graybil and Jerline Clavarie.

He is survived by his daughter, Gina Smith and husband, Heath, Martha, OK; 2 grandchildren, Logan Smith, Okmulgee, OK and Colton Smith, Martha, OK; 2 sisters, Wanda McConnell, Medford, OR and Carolyn Thompson and husband, Johnny, Elk City, OK; 2 brothers, Jack White and wife, Carian, and Billy White and wife, Lynda, both of Elk City, OK; 2 step daughters, Bonnie Lathrom and husband, Scott Dotter and Ginger Baker and husband, Rex, all of Butler, OK and a host of other relatives and friends.
